Tetap teratur dengan koleksi
Simpan dan kategorikan konten berdasarkan preferensi Anda.
Layanan Google Play memiliki dua API yang dapat Anda gunakan untuk menyederhanakan proses verifikasi berbasis SMS: SMS Retriever API dan SMS User Consent API.
SMS Retriever API memberikan pengalaman pengguna yang sepenuhnya otomatis dan harus digunakan jika memungkinkan. Namun, Anda harus menempatkan kode hash kustom dalam isi pesan, dan hal ini mungkin sulit dilakukan jika Anda bukan pengirim pesan tersebut.
Jika tidak memiliki kontrol atas konten pesan—misalnya, jika aplikasi Anda bekerja sama dengan lembaga keuangan yang mungkin ingin memverifikasi nomor telepon pengguna sebelum menyetujui transaksi pembayaran di dalam aplikasi—Anda dapat menggunakan SMS User Consent API, yang tidak memerlukan kode hash kustom. Namun, cara ini mengharuskan pengguna untuk menyetujui permintaan aplikasi Anda agar dapat mengakses pesan yang berisi kode verifikasi. Untuk meminimalkan kemungkinan munculnya pesan yang salah kepada pengguna, Izin Pengguna SMS akan memeriksa apakah pesan tersebut berisi kode alfanumerik 4-10 karakter yang berisi setidaknya satu angka. Tindakan ini juga akan memfilter pesan dari pengirim dalam daftar Kontak
pengguna.
Perbedaannya dirangkum dalam tabel di bawah:
Pengambil SMS
Izin Pengguna SMS
Persyaratan pesan
Kode hash 11 digit yang mengidentifikasi aplikasi Anda secara unik
Kode alfanumerik 4-10 digit yang berisi minimal satu angka
Persyaratan pengirim
None
Pengirim tidak boleh ada dalam daftar Kontak pengguna
[[["Mudah dipahami","easyToUnderstand","thumb-up"],["Memecahkan masalah saya","solvedMyProblem","thumb-up"],["Lainnya","otherUp","thumb-up"]],[["Informasi yang saya butuhkan tidak ada","missingTheInformationINeed","thumb-down"],["Terlalu rumit/langkahnya terlalu banyak","tooComplicatedTooManySteps","thumb-down"],["Sudah usang","outOfDate","thumb-down"],["Masalah terjemahan","translationIssue","thumb-down"],["Masalah kode / contoh","samplesCodeIssue","thumb-down"],["Lainnya","otherDown","thumb-down"]],["Terakhir diperbarui pada 2022-10-18 UTC."],[[["Google Play services offers two APIs, SMS Retriever and SMS User Consent, to simplify SMS-based verification in your app."],["SMS Retriever API automates verification but requires a custom hash code in the SMS message, ideal when you control message content."],["SMS User Consent API, best for scenarios where you don't control the SMS message (like with financial institutions), requires user approval to access the message but doesn't need a custom hash code."],["SMS User Consent API enhances security by filtering messages from known contacts and focusing on messages containing a 4-10 digit alphanumeric code with at least one number."]]],[]]